I don't think you want to use anything to "soften" or lube the holster. The plastic baggie would probably be the best bet. You want to stretch the leather to fit the gun, but you don't want to compromise the retention of the leather with respect to friction. If the baggie doesn't work, I would just maybe double bag it and try again.
